Description

An immaculately presented and conveniently located one bedroom apartment offering bright accommodation with the benefit of secure gated parking.
The apartment features a Sitting Room with access to a balcony, attractive and well equipped kitchen, spacious bedroom and the block has the benefit of a lift. Available with no upper chain.

Communal Entrance. 


Front dooring leading to a spacious Entrance Hall with storage cupboard and cupboard housing hot water cylinder. 


Sitting Room with benefit of a large picture window and double doors leading to a balcony.

Open Plan Kitchen fitted with a good range of quality wall and base units and a centre island/breakfast bar area, integrated hob and oven with overhead extractor, integrated fridge/freezer and half sized dishwasher, space and plumbing for washing machine. 


Double Bedroom with space for wardrobe cupboards.


Bathroom comprising of a paneled bath with overbath shower and screen, WC, wash hand basin, tiled flooring and walls. 


Secure Gated Parking provision for one vehicle. 


Terms
Leasehold: 104 years unexpired.
Service Charge: £1800.00 per annum
Ground Rent: £413.00 per annum.
EPC Rating: C Council Tax Band: C         



Carnegie Court is an attractive modern apartment block located in the centre  of Farnham Common Village. The open spaces of Burnham Beeches are close by, as is the M40 (J2) 2.5 miles, Gerrards Cross 3.6 miles, Beaconsfield 4.5 miles, Heathrow Airport 15.0 miles. All distances are approximate. The Village of Farnham Common offers a comprehensive selection of shopping, restaurants and other outlets such as a post office, pharmacy and a home improvements store. Burnham Beeches is close by with hundreds of acres of protected woodland, offering attractive walks and a café. Trains to London (Paddington) are available from Burnham, Taplow and Maidenhead. The Elizabeth Line from Burnham or Slough gives a fast service to Canary Wharf, the City and the West End.



Alternatively, Gerrards Cross and Beaconsfield provide the Chiltern Line into London Marylebone. Buckinghamshire is renowned for its choice and standard of schooling. The county is one of the last to maintain Grammar Schools with Burnham Grammar (for girls and boys) together with The Royal Grammar School and John Hampden in High Wycombe (for boys) and Beaconsfield High School (for girls). Independent preparatory schools include St Mary’s, Godstowe, High March (for girls) Caldicott, Davenies (for boys) and Dair House (for boys and girls).
